There are a few factors that made life hard for the daigou. One is COVID-19, which of course has crippled tourism from China and hit international student numbers.
Another would appear to be customer demand back in China; online pricing has been subdued, so daigou have been slow to re-enter the market and promote the a2 brand, the company says.
